Laser Hair Removal Laser Hair Removal is a light based treatment used to permanently reduce hair. Currently we use many different lasers (Prowave and CoolGlide Vantage by Cutera and the Comet and Aurora by Syneron) for hair removal treatments which allow us to safely and effectively treat any type of skin and hair color. Unfortunately, with every hair removal treatment, maintenance is needed because the body naturally over time produces new hair cells. We encourage our patients to have maintenance treatments on a routine basis to treat new growth. For the facial area maintenance is generally recommended every 3-4 months. For the body, some patients only need 1-2 maintenance treatments a year, but can range from 1-4 treatments a year. Some patients find this difficult to commit to. Most laser and light devices rely on a pigmented target (freckle, blood vessel, hair follicle, etc). If we treat over an area that is tan or recently exposed to the sun, the active melanocytes and extra pigment in the skin also act as a target for the laser energy. This increases the risk of complications or requires us to turn down the energy to a safe enough level which may not always be effective. A great alternative in the summer is SonoPeels™ and BetaPeels. The SonoPeel™ uses ultrasonic energy and gentle cavitational forces to remove the dead, scaly outer layer of the skin, called the epidermis. BetaPeels use salicylic acid, also known as beta-hydroxy acid, to gently exfoliate the dead surface cells and promote regeneration and renewal of the skin. Treatments will reduce sun damage, improve the skin's overall tone and texture, reduce acne breakouts and can safely be performed during the summer!

Summer Skin Concerns Summer is here and with the beautiful weather we will all be outdoors more often. With this comes all of the wonderful rashes/eruptions that cause us to itch like crazy! The most common problems include PMLE (aka sun poisoning), bug bites and poison ivy. Here are some tips to try to avoid these problems and to treat them when they do erupt: 
 
PMLE (sun poisoning) is best avoided by using a physical block that contains zinc oxide and/or titanium dioxide. Regular over the counter sunscreens that claim to have UVA/UVB protection will not help to prevent this condition if these ingredients are not present, so read your labels! Wearing sun protective clothing (coolibar.com, also available in skinfo) is also helpful and if you do have a rash from the sun, an over the counter cortisone cream will often help to calm down the reaction. Prescription products can be necessary with a severe eruption.
 
Bug Bites Use insect repellent to help prevent the bites from occurring, but if you do get a bug bite take an antihistamine (Claritin, Benadryl) and apply ice and hydrocortisone cream to relieve the itching. If you are VERY prone to a more intense reaction to the bite, you may benefit from taking a daily antihistamine to help prevent the swelling and itching. Please refrain from applying sunscreens combined with insect repellant! We need to reapply sunscreen often and if insect repellents are applied too frequently they can cause toxicity in our nervous system.

Poison ivy or sumac If you come in contact with a "poisonous" plant be sure to take a shower right away to get the rhus antigen (the chemical that is the allergen) off of your skin. If you think you got it on your clothes be sure to wash these items as well and gives animals a bath if they have been rolling in the plant. Usually you need a higher strength topical steroid than OTC products to get rid of the rash, but antihistamines, cortisone creams and compresses like Domeboro's can help to soothe the skin.
  
Warts and Molluscum Warts are non-cancerous skin growths caused by a viral infection in the top layer of the skin. Viruses that cause warts are called human papillomavirus (HPV). Warts are usually skin-colored and feel rough to the touch, but they can be dark, flat and smooth. The appearance of a wart depends on where it is growing. Warts are passed from person to person, sometimes indirectly. The time from the first contact to the time the warts have grown large enough to be seen is often several months. We offer a wide variety of successful treatments for warts and we are able to customize treatments for each patient. The treatments include a prescription cream applied to the warts daily, an oral pill taken daily, freezing the wart with liquid nitrogen, or an injection into each wart with either an anti-cancer drug called bleomycin or an immunotherapy drug called candida. Molluscum contagiosum is also a common skin disease caused by a virus which affects the top layers of the skin. The name molluscum contagiosum implies that the virus develops growths that are easily spread by skin contact. Similar to warts, this virus belongs to the poxvirus family and enters the skin through small breaks of hair follicles. It can also be spread through a warm pool or bath water. Molluscum is usually small flesh-colored or pink dome-shaped growths that often become red or inflamed. They may appear shiny and have a small indentation in the center. We have effective treatments to eradicate molluscum. These treatments include cantharidin also known as "beetle juice" which is painted on each molluscum, a prescription topical cream used at home, or removal of the molluscum via liquid nitrogen or curettage.

Leg Veins: Reticular vs Spider vs Varicose Veins Now that we have shorts weather here we might notice a few more unwanted spider veins on our legs. Most veins on the legs are there due to superficial stretched small reddish, purple veins called spider veins (less than 0.3 cm - about 1/5th inch) or larger blue reticular veins, 0.3-6 mm vessels (up to 1/5th inch). These vessels are not necessary for proper functioning of the leg and thus are a cosmetic annoyance. These can usually be treated with excellent results with sclerotherapy and/or laser treatments in our office. During a consultation, the provider will assess your veins to determine which treatment plan will benefit you the most. In many cases a combination of sclerotherapy and laser treatments yield the best result. (See Aesthetic News for more info on these treatments.) Cellex-C Spider Vein Complex, available at Skinfo, is an easily applied spray containing ingredients which stabilize blood vessels, making them less stretched and leaky and appear lighter. It improves the appearance of leg veins alone and is also a great adjunct to sclerotherapy and laser to speed healing between treatments. Some leg veins are just too large or advanced to be able to benefit from the procedures we offer at Advanced Dermatology. These are very large vessels called varicose veins, which are greater than 0.6 cm and usually blue, ropy and elevated off the surface of the skin. These veins frequently are associated with an underlying abnormal valve behind the knee or in the groin which needs to be fixed in order to have successful treatment of the varicose vein. This valvular treatment usually requires either a more invasive laser procedure, ultrasound-guided sclerotherapy or surgical removal. Don't hesitate to make a consultation visit. We will let you know what the appropriate therapy is for your legs and if we cannot help you we will direct you to another respected professional who can perform these more invasive procedures.

Silk'n™ by Home Skinovations* Silk'n™ is a personal Photo-Epilation device for long-term hair removal. The term photo-epilation describes the use of pulsed light to remove unwanted hair. Silk'n™ removes hair by emitting a pulse of light that is absorbed by pigment in the hair shaft beneath the skin surface. This disables the hair follicle and delays hair growth. Silk'n™ has been designed for safe, convenient and effective hair removal in the privacy of ones own home. It is recommended for treatment of brown or black pigmented hairs on the underarms, bikini line, arms and legs (not designed for facial hair removal).
